Giants’ Kelby Tomlinson hits inside-the-park homer — a 1st The fastest guy in the Giants’ organization had never legged out an inside-the-park home run until Saturday. Tomlinson’s first-inning drive to right-center wasn’t defended well. Two Colorado outfielders seemed hesitant, and the relay throw home was soft. “I always thought it would be pretty cool to get one,” the second baseman said. With impressive speed and instincts, Tomlinson will work in the outfield in the offseason to improve his versatility. Aside from his home run, he turned a single into a double, hustled to first to avoid a double play and made a back-to-the-plate catch of a popup.
